Fidelity Investments, founded in 1946 by Edward C. Johnson II and headquartered in Boston, Massachusetts, is one of the largest privately-held financial services firms in the world, managing hundreds of billions in assets. Known for its wide array of investment products, including mutual funds, retirement accounts, brokerage services, and wealth management, Fidelity caters to both individual investors and institutions with a reputation for strong customer service and innovative tools like its active trader platforms. The company pioneered direct-to-investor mutual fund sales, bypassing traditional brokers, and has since expanded into areas like cryptocurrency trading and commission-free stock trades. Still family-controlled by the Johnson family, Fidelity blends a legacy of traditional investing with a forward-looking approach to technology and market trends.

Fidelity Investments's Q1 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2019, Fidelity Investments held 4,578 positions worth $835B, up 14% from $730B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 22% of the portfolio.

Fidelity Investments's Q1 2019 filing shows 344 new, 1,400 increased, 1,657 reduced and 581 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Lyft: 20,390,416 shares worth $1.45B. The largest sale was TotalEnergies, an estimated $6.17B.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 20% of assets, up from 19%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.
